GOT HIS DESERTS
LEGAL “SHARK” GAOLED. “MENACE TO SOCIETY.” The greatest menace in Sydney for many years, .received his deserts last week when Harry Fane Becher (36), a lawyer’s clerk, was sentenced to two years’ hard labor for conSP Becher, during his career .in Sydney, has been associated with nine 'solicitors, and each one, in an effort to repair the harm, that Becher has done, has been ruined. One vas struck off the rolls in circumstances that, in view of' Becher s enc b. suggests that a wrong was done himIn addition to tho trouble that he has caused in‘this direction, the character 'that was given Becher utter his conviction by Detective Ser geant-Lawrence is illuminating.
